A flower garden should be full of fragrance - choose flowers with strong smell. A rose, for example, has a strong smell that will fill the air around it. Other flowers with strong smells include ginger, jasmine, and lavender. These plants are perfect for adding fragrance to a flower garden.
A garden must be colorful and inviting - use brightlycolored flowers and plants. The flowers and plants should be in bloom, adding a touch of brightness to the garden. Different colors can create a more cheerful atmosphere, so choose plants that are complementary to each other. If you have a sunny spot in your garden, try planting some sunflowers or geraniums; if your garden has a shady side, plant clematis or ivy.
